Frequently Asked Questions about Rent Specials the 30310 ZIP Code Apartments

What is the Cheapest Rent Specials apartment in 30310?

Currently the most affordable Rent Specials Apartment in 30310 is at Vintage Square Apartment Homes listed at $1,299.

How much is the average rent for a Rent Specials 30310 Apartment?

The average rent for a Rent Specials Apartment in 30310 is $1,436.

What is the largest Rent Specials 30310 Apartment for rent?

Today's Rent Specials apartment with the most square footage in 30310 is a 925 square feet unit starting from $1,449 at St. Francis Village Apartments.

What is the average size for 30310 Rent Specials Apartments for rent?

The average size for a Rent Specials rental in 30310 is currently at 775 sq ft.
